Sodium Cyanide: Properties and Hazards
Sodium cyanide is a highly poisonous chemical compound with the formula NaCN. It is a white, crystalline powder that is readily mixable in water. Sodium cyanide has various industrial uses, including metal refining and electroplating. However, its extreme toxicity poses considerable hazards to human more info health and the environment.
Exposure to sodium cyanide can occur through ingestion. Even small amounts can be fatal. Symptoms of toxicity include headache, nausea, vomiting, dizziness, and respiratory distress. In severe cases, exposure can lead to cardiac arrest and death within minutes. NaCN Formula: Structure and Chemical Identity
Sodium cyanide, represented by the chemical expression NaCN, is a fascinating molecule with significant industrial applications. Its structure consists of a single sodium atom (Na|sodium ion|Na+) connected to a cyanide ion (CN-). This link between the two elements results in a highly reactive compound.
The cyanide ion itself has a triple bond between carbon and nitrogen, contributing to its harmfulness. Understanding the Toxicity of Sodium Cyanide
Sodium cyanide acts as a dangerous chemical threat. Even in small quantities, it can result in deadly consequences. When absorbed through the lungs, sodium cyanide hinders the body's power to process oxygen, leading to instant cell death. Exposure with skin or eyes can also generate severe damage.
